Data are based on individual countries' national accounts statistics. For many countries, the estimates of national saving are built up from national accounts data on gross domestic investment and from balance of payments-based data on net foreign investment. Gross National Savings (% of GDP) Statistics for Bahamas (The Bahamas), Year 2010 - In Detail

Gross National Savings (% of GDP) for Bahamas in year 2010 is 17.537 %

This makes Bahamas No. 96 in world rankings according to Gross National Savings (% of GDP) in year 2010. The world's average Gross National Savings (% of GDP) value is 18.64 %; Bahamas is 1.10 less than the average.

In the previous year, 2009, Gross National Savings (% of GDP) for Bahamas was 18.41 % Gross National Savings (% of GDP) for Bahamas in 2010 was or will be 4.74% less than it was or will be in 2009.

In the following or forecasted year, 2011, Gross National Savings (% of GDP) for Bahamas was or will be 15.44 %, which is 11.97% less than the 2010 figure.
